数据库age int是什么意思
-
在数据库中,age int表示一个存储年龄的字段,其中int是数据类型的一种。int是整数类型,用于存储整数值。age字段被定义为int类型,意味着该字段只能存储整数值,不能存储小数或文本等其他类型的值。
以下是关于数据库age int的几点说明:
-
数据类型:int是一种整数类型,用于存储整数值。在大多数数据库中,int通常占据4个字节的存储空间,可以表示的整数范围为-2,147,483,648到2,147,483,647。
-
数据限制:由于age字段被定义为int类型,它将受到整数类型的限制。这意味着age字段只能存储整数值,不能存储小数、文本或其他类型的值。
-
数据范围:由于int类型的限制,age字段只能存储特定范围内的整数值。在上述示例中,age字段可以存储的整数范围为-2,147,483,648到2,147,483,647。如果需要存储超出该范围的值,可以考虑使用其他数据类型,如bigint。
-
整数运算:由于age字段是int类型,可以对其进行整数运算。这意味着可以对age字段进行加减乘除等数学运算,以及比较运算符(例如大于、小于等)。
-
空值处理:如果age字段允许为空值,可以将其定义为可空int类型(nullable int)。这样,age字段可以存储整数值,也可以存储空值(null),表示年龄未知或不适用的情况。
总之,数据库中的age int表示一个整数类型的年龄字段,可以存储特定范围内的整数值,并可以进行整数运算。
1年前 -
-
数据库中的age int是指一个名为age的字段,它的数据类型为整数(integer)。这意味着该字段只能存储整数值,例如1、2、3等。整数类型通常用来存储不需要小数部分的数字,比如年龄、数量等。
使用整数类型的好处是它占用的存储空间较小,计算速度较快。而且,整数类型可以进行数值运算,比如加、减、乘、除等操作。
在数据库中,定义字段的数据类型是为了约束字段的取值范围,确保数据的一致性和完整性。使用整数类型来存储age字段,可以限制该字段的取值只能是整数,避免了数据类型不匹配的问题。
需要注意的是,int类型的取值范围是有限的,一般是-2147483648到2147483647之间(32位操作系统)。如果需要存储更大的整数值,可以使用bigint类型。另外,如果age字段可能存在小数部分,可以考虑使用浮点数类型(如float或double)。
1年前 -
在数据库中,age int是指一个名为"age"的列,其数据类型为整数(integer)。
"int"是整数的缩写,表示该列只能存储整数类型的值。整数是指没有小数点和小数部分的数字,可以是正数、负数或零。在数据库中,整数类型通常用于存储年龄、数量、计数等整数值。
通过将age列定义为整数类型,可以确保存储在该列中的值是合法的整数,而不是其他数据类型,如字符串或浮点数。这有助于提高数据的一致性和查询的效率。
在创建数据库表时,可以使用类似以下的SQL语句定义age列为整数类型:
CREATE TABLE 表名 (
…
age int,
…
);在插入数据时,需要确保插入的值是一个合法的整数,否则会导致插入失败或出现数据异常。例如,以下SQL语句将在age列中插入一个整数值:
INSERT INTO 表名 (age) VALUES (25);
在查询数据时,可以使用类似以下的SQL语句检索age列的整数值:
SELECT age FROM 表名;
此查询将返回age列中的所有整数值。
总之,age int表示数据库表中的一个整数类型的列,用于存储整数值,如年龄、数量等。
1年前